Myotherapy is a form of physical therapy focused on assessing, treating, and managing musculoskeletal pain and dysfunction. It targets issues affecting muscles, joints, tendons, ligaments, and connective tissue to help restore movement, reduce pain, and improve overall physical wellbeing.
Myotherapists use a range of hands-on techniques such as deep tissue massage, trigger point therapy, dry needling, joint mobilisation, and corrective exercises. Treatment is tailored to each individual and may also include posture correction, stretching programs, and lifestyle advice.
Myotherapy is commonly used to treat conditions like back and neck pain, headaches, sports injuries, muscle tightness, and chronic pain. It can benefit people of all ages—from office workers experiencing postural strain to athletes recovering from injury.
By addressing the underlying causes of discomfort rather than just the symptoms, myotherapy aims to support long-term recovery, prevent re-injury, and enhance physical performance and mobility.
During your initial visit, we'll ask you about your medical history, any specific areas you'd like us to focus on, do any orthopedic testing if needed and discuss a treatment plan for the session. Then, we'll leave the room to give you privacy while you undress to your comfort level and lay down on the massage table. We'll use a towel to cover any areas of your body that aren't being massaged. You can communicate with us throughout the session to let us know if you'd like different pressure, or if you're feeling uncomfortable in any way.
